192 * gtk/gtktextview.[ch]: No longer inherit from GtkLayout; instead
193 handle the adjustments ourselves, and scroll as necessary using
194 the new gdk_window_scroll().
196 The advantage of this is that when we are incrementally revalidating,
197 we are essentially rearranging things around the visible portion
198 of the screen. With the old setup, the visible portion of the
199 screen was moved around in the layout, so scrolling and redrawing
200 to track that caused jumping of the display. Since we now
201 control the scrolling ourselves, we can suppress this and
202 only redraw when things actually change.

862 * gtk/gtkviewport.c: SHAME! ok this one is tricky, so i note it
863 here, those reading: learn from my mistake! ;)
864 in order for set_?adjustment to support a default adjustemnt if
865 invoked with an adjustment pointer of NULL, the code read (pseudo):
866 if (v->adjustment) unref (v->adjustment);
867 if (!adjustment) adjustment = adjustment_new ();
868 if (v->adjustment != adjustment) v->adjustment = ref (adjustment);
869 now imagine the first unref to actually free the old adjustment and
870 adjustment_new() creating a new adjustment from the very same memory
871 portion. here, the latter comparision will unintendedly fail, and
872 all hell breaks loose.
873 (gtk_viewport_set_hadjustment):
874 (gtk_viewport_set_vadjustment): reset viewport->?adjustment to NULL
875 after unreferencing it.

1304 * gdk/gdkwindow.c gdk/gdkprivate.h: Add facility for
1305 double-buffered drawing. gdk_window_begin_paint_{rect,region}()
1306 create a backing pixmap and redirect all drawing to
1307 that backing pixmap until a matching gdk_window_end_paint().
1309 * gdk/gdkwindow.[ch] gdk/gdkinternals.h gdk/x11/gdkdrawable-x11.c:
1310 Create a special drawable class for GtkWindow's that
1311 redirects the drawing to the backing pixmap as necessary
1312 and then calls the real operations in _gdk_windowing_window_class.
1314 * gdk/gdkprivate.h gdk/gdkwindow.[ch] gdk/x11/gdkevents-x11.c:
1315 Store invalid region for each window. Generate expose events for invalid
1316 region in an idle. This replaces both the expose compression
1317 and the redrawing queuing in GTK+. It is both more efficient and
1318 simpler than either one individually and far more so then the
1321 * gdk/x11/gdkgeometry.c gdk/x11/gdkwindow.c gdk/x11/gdkprivate-x11.h:
1322 Emulate 32 bit coordinates for windows with 16 bit coordinates
1323 by offsetting drawing, guffaw scrolling techniques and
1324 mapping/unmapping child windows as necessary.
1326 * gdk/gdkwindow.[ch] gdk/x11/gdkgeometry.c: Add anti-exposes,
1327 where, when invalid regions are processed, the region is stored,
1328 and if expose events come in that are detectably duplicate
1329 the processed exposes (by comparison of event serial numbers),
1330 the stored region is subtracted out of those exposes.
1332 * gdk/x11/gdkgeometry.c: Temporarily unset backing pixmaps of
1333 regions newly exposed when scrolling or resizing windows.
1334 This, combined with forcing processesing of queued invalidated
1335 regions, gives nice flicker-free scrolling.
